Free, tailored support for new headteachers 

The Early Headship Coaching Offer is a free programme that gives new headteachers the tools to become more effective in their role.

To be eligible for this targeted package, you need to be in your first five years of headship at a state funded school and have previously done an NPQ for Headship (NPQH) or be currently on a programme with Teach First or another provider. 

How does it work? 

Over the course of a year, you’ll get: 

  • one-to-one support from an experienced former school leader 
  • five coaching calls tailored to you and your needs 
  • a confidential, safe space to reflect and discuss personal or school priorities 
  • practical guidance focused on your school’s particular circumstances. 

There is no pre-work or preparation needed for sessions other than personal reflection time and there is no assessment.
